A Vacancy at Royal Free London NHS Foundation Trust.Substantive Consultant Medical Oncologist (GI cancer) (Royal Free and Chase Farm Hospitals) 10 PAs. The Royal Free London NHS Foundation Trust is one of the largest and busiest Trusts in London with a well-established national and international reputation for clinical excellence and world-class care. In January 2025, the Royal Free London and North Middlesex University Hospitals Trusts merged, and we now deliver care to over 2 million people a year through our four main hospitals. There are infusion suites to treat cancer patients at The Royal Free, Finchley Memorial, North Middlesex and Chase Farm Hospitals whilst radiotherapy is delivered at the Royal Free and North Middlesex Hospital. The post-holder will work alongside medical and clinical oncology colleagues at the Royal Free hospitals and will be essential for service provision as well as the development of the gastrointestinal and NET pathways. The successful candidate should have experience of working within a multidisciplinary team; have a wide experience in Medical Oncology but in particular in gastrointestinal cancer management. The post-holder will join the oncology team at the Royal Free London NHS Foundation Trust (RFL) as a 10PA substantive consultant. The post will cover Gastrointestinal cancers and NET at Royal Free Hospital and Chase Farm health units. Medical oncology GI clinics are based at the Royal Free and CF health units, supported by 2 RFH medical oncologists and other staff, and there is a cross-site GI cancer MDT for Royal Free, Barnet and Chase Farm.
